Norah Carter
Norah Carter (1881–1966) was a New Zealand photographer and painter.
Also recorded as Nora Carter; Miss N. Carter; N. Carter.

Overview
Born at New Zealand in 1881, died at Sydney in 1966.
In detail
Norah Carter studied at Wellington High School.
The field of work recorded is photography.
Work by Norah Carter is recorded in the collections of Museum of New Zealand Te Papa Tongarewa.
